Burnsville, MN is a city of around 61,000 people located in the greater Minneapolis–Saint Paul region. It offers families and individuals access to top-notch educational opportunities. The city is served by two school districts: the Burnsville-Eagan-Savage School District 191 and the Rosemount-Apple Valley-Eagan School District 196. Burnsville schools spend $13,586 per student (The US average is $12,383). There are 15 pupils per teacher, 685 students per librarian, and 728 children per counselor.
